## Changelog — Catalog v7.9 (Key Rotation)

Heads up for the sync: we rotated the signing key for the Shelfworks catalog cache-invalidation pipeline. Quick recap — stale product pages last week traced back to invalidation messages being dropped because the old key expired quietly. We've added expiry alerts so that won't sneak up again. All publishers must re-sign their invalidation hooks before Thursday's deploy window, or cache busts will silently no-op. Staging is already on the new key. For anyone updating hooks, the new signing key follows.

rollout seal: bky4_x7Gc

Ticket #4471 — Pop-up office, Hall C, Verrow Trade Fair. The partition walls went up overnight and the kettle, router, and banner stand are all in place. Team assistants can start stocking the booth from 7am tomorrow. Heads up: the hall uses its own access system, so your normal badges won't work. Use the pass below to get through the side door.

staff pass of kawip-hawef = bdg-QLP-2

## Further Reading

If you're building a plugin against the Hollowgate occupancy feed, start with the schema notes before touching the polling API. The feed publishes per-level counts every 30 seconds, but sensor dropouts can produce brief negative deltas, and your plugin must treat those as no-ops rather than corrections. Rate limits are per consumer key, and backfill requests are batched nightly. All of this — schema versions, dropout semantics, and the deprecation calendar — is maintained on the internal reference page here.

runbook for badug-kadup: https://confluence.zemvarlabs.internal/projects/browse/display/projects/bd1b

Q: FixtureForge seeding job fails with "sealed corpus" on the staging cluster — how do I recover?
A: The test-data factory encrypts its canonical corpus between runs. If the unseal step times out, the run aborts and pages on-call. Restart the seeder with the --unseal flag; when it prompts, enter the recovery passphrase provided directly below this entry.

unlock words, kawig-bawef: belax-sorir-druax-ulaiel-wenael-belael